Understanding the Types of Headsets

Before diving into the particular functions of headsets for sale, it is necessary to understand the different types readily available. Each type serves unique functions and includes various performances.

1. Wired Headsets

Wired headsets link to devices using a cable television, generally with a 3.5 mm jack or USB connector. They are understood for providing high-quality audio without latency concerns.

Pros:

  • Reliable connection
  • No battery requirements
  • Normally more economical

Cons:

  • Limited mobility
  • Can be cumbersome to utilize

2. Wireless Headsets

Wireless headsets count on Bluetooth innovation to link to gadgets, permitting higher flexibility of movement.

Pros:

  • Enhanced mobility
  • Tidy, cable-free experience
  • Lots of feature active noise cancellation

Cons:

  • Battery-dependent
  • Possible latency concerns in audio quality

3. Gaming Headsets

Gaming headsets are specifically created for players, typically featuring immersive noise and a top quality microphone. They may can be found in wired or wireless options.

Pros:

  • Surround sound capabilities
  • Boosted microphone for clear communication
  • Extra features like personalized RGB lighting

Cons:

  • Can be bulky
  • In some cases less appropriate for casual listening

4. Company Headsets

Customized for professional use, service headsets often include noise-cancellation technology, comfort for long wear, and features suitable for conference calls.

Pros:

  • Comfort for extended use
  • Noise-cancellation boosts focus
  • Clear audio for calls

Cons:

  • Can be pricey
  • Restricted style options

5. Sports Headsets

Created for active usage, sports headsets use sweat resistance and secure fit, ensuring they remain in place during exercises.

Pros:

  • Sweat-proof and durable
  • Light-weight and protected fit
  • Typically consist of features like heart rate monitoring

Cons:

  • Usually do not have noise seclusion
  • Sound quality may be lower than non-sport designs

Tips for Buying the Right Headset

  1. Specify Your Purpose: Be clear on how you prepare to utilize the headset-- gaming, work, music, or fitness.
  2. Set a Budget: Determine a price range that fits your monetary situation while considering functions that are required.
  3. Attempt Before You Buy: Whenever possible, test headsets to assess comfort and sound quality.
  4. Evaluation the Return Policy: Ensure that the retailer has a return policy in case the headset does not fulfill your expectations.
  5. Check Out Customer Reviews: Gain insights from other users to identify strengths and weaknesses.

FAQs About Headsets

Q1: How do I know if a headset works with my gadget?

A1: Always examine the headset requirements for compatibility with your gadget. The majority of makers supply detailed details regarding connection types.

Q2: Is the sound quality in wireless headsets as good as wired?

A2: While lots of high-end wireless headsets provide equivalent sound quality to their wired counterparts, budget plan models might experience latency or lower fidelity.

Q3: How can I preserve my headset?

A3: Keep your headset clean, prevent exposing it to severe temperatures, and store it in a safe place to extend its life-span.

Q4: What should I do if the microphone isn't working?

A4: Check the connections, make sure settings on your device are configured properly, and reboot your gadget. If problems continue, consult the producer's support.

Q5: Are there headsets created for particular ear shapes?

A5: Yes! Some brands use headsets with adjustable ear ideas or adjustability functions to improve convenience for various ear shapes.
